    They both portray that life does not end after human life. And also touch on the subject that a soul could be trapped on earth, as well as having unfinished business to attend to.

    I do think, however, that in the case of sixth sense that he went longer than would of been realistic in knowing that he passed over. After all, he would have only been talking to the boy.. And well, being married and what have you. And not being able to talk to people. You would kind of realize something was amiss.

    Both movies do not really go into what the after life would be.. Just what it would be like if you were still on earth, after your physical life ended.
